THE PHOTOGRAPHER’S EYE – LOOK BEFORE YOU SHOOT

This Workshop will consist of two/2 Hour Sessions: Wednesday October 31st, 9:30am – 11:30am  And Wednesday November 7th, 9:30am – 11:30am.                                                  The cost for the 2 day workshop is $25.00

Photography is more than just pushing the shutter release button on your camera. NO matter what type of photographs you enjoy taking , seeing and composing before you shoot is the best way to end up with the image that you want. This workshop will guide participants towards seeing before they photograph. There will be explanations, exercises visuals and class discussions to help you take that next step as a photographer. 

 “No longer is a camera taking pictures for me, I am using the camera to take the pictures I first feel and then see. It is, for me, about authenticity” – David Pinkham

NOTE: The workshop is for photographers with a working knowledge of their camera. It is not a workshop for beginners or for those using point/shoot cameras or smart phones. Please bring your digital cameras to class for each session.

David is the owner of DS Pinkham Photography. He is currently teaching photography workshops throughout in Rhode Island and Massachusetts. He is a member of Newport Art Museum, Rhode Island Center for Photographic Art, Providence Art Club He has had exhibits at Blithewold , Bristol Art Museum, Newport Art Museum, Peter Miller Fine Art Photography Galey and more.
